Just started out with Insteon. I've got a 2412N controller, a couple dual-band access points, 1 plug-in dimmer, 1 switch relay, and just got a Toggleline 2466DW.

I can add the Toggleline to the 2412N controller's panel. I can get it's status. If I manually turn the Togglelinc on, I can turn it off via the controller's panel. However, I cannot turn it on.

I tried removing the unit from the panel then adding it again. Still doesn't work.

I appreciate any help on this.

Make sure it is on when you link it. Remotely turning it "on" will actually just return it to the same state it was in when you linked it. If it was off then, it will turn off now.

That worked! It seems weird that it has to be setup this way, but at least it works now. Thanks so much.

It does seem weird (and it didn't used to be this way), but it's actually useful. Because of this, you can set up a switch (or a button on a KeypadLinc) that turns on some lights while turning off others. For example turn on a nightlight and turn off the main room light.
